The Red Neon Blue-eye (Pseudomugil luminatus) is a dazzling nano fish that brings vibrant flashes of color and activity to the freshwater aquarium. These tiny fish reach a maximum size of about 1.2 inches (3 cm) and are admired for their glowing red-orange bodies, electric blue eyes, and delicate, flowing fins edged in iridescent highlights. Best kept in groups of six or more, they are lively schoolers that display fascinating social interactions and feel most secure and vibrant when in the company of their own kind. Ideal water parameters for P. luminatus include a temperature of 72–80°F (22–27°C), a pH between 6.0 and 7.5, and soft to moderately hard water (5–15 dGH). Despite their bold coloration, they are peaceful and gentle, making them excellent companions for other small, non-aggressive fish in a well-planted community tank.
